Bleu d’Auvergne is a French blue cheese from the Auvergne region, made from pasteurized cow’s milk. It has a soft, creamy texture and a well-distributed marbling of blue veins. Compared to sharper blue cheeses like Roquefort, Bleu d’Auvergne is more approachable, with a salty, lightly spiced flavor that balances beautifully with the creaminess of the cheese.
-
Origin: France (Auvergne)
-
Milk type: Pasteurized cow’s milk
-
Texture: Soft and creamy, slightly crumbly when cut
-
Flavor: Gently salty, lightly herbal, mildly tangy
-
Rind: Natural rind, sometimes slightly moist from aging
